
P V Sindhu and Lakshya Sen suffered straight-game losses to their respective opponents in the women’s and men’s singles quarter-finals, marking the end of Indian challenge in the USD 500,000 Indonesia Masters badminton tournament here on Friday.
Sindhu lost to top seed and World No. 4 Chen Yu Fei of China 13-21, 17-21 in the quarter-final contest that lasted 42 minutes to bow out of the Super 500 event.
In the men’s singles, Lakshya, a 2021 world championships bronze medallist, was beaten 18-21, 20-22 by Thailand’s Panitchaphon Teeraratsakul in a match that lasted 46 minutes.
